The effffect of Free Water and Rust on Flash Point of Diesel
Diesel is used as a fuel in many of the engines in commercial and industrial scale. Distractions encountered during the auto-ignition due to presence of water and rust in the engine or in the fuel are studied by measuring Flash point. There is increase in flash points due to presence of water, which shows free water drops are not good to present in diesel. Also this study helps to judge the quality of fuel from the bottom of the tank which is mostly havnig water drops and rust (solids).
